Introduction
Hotset is a distributor of Hi-Watty Light, an Aluminum Nitride (AIN) heater developed by Watty Corporation, headquartered in Tokyo. This product is designed for rapid heating using ceramic materials to meet diverse customer needs across various industries such as semiconductor, medical care, aerospace, and railway.

Product Features
The Hi-Watty Light AIN heater offers fast heating and cooling capabilities, high thermal conductivity similar to metallic aluminum, a small coefficient of thermal expansion, excellent electrical insulation, corrosion resistance, high power density, and cost-effectiveness. It is suitable for heating gas, liquids, and piping systems.

Technical Specifications
  • Max. Operating Temperature: 400 °C / 752 °F
  • Heating Material: Tungsten
  • Thermal Conductivity: 180 W/m·K or higher
  • Thermal Expansion Rate: 4.8 × 10-6 / °C
  • Volume Resistivity: 2.6 × 1014 Ω·cm (25 °C / 77 °F)

Dimensions and Options
  • Available sizes range from 12.0 x 2.5 mm to 50.0 x 2.5 mm
  • Voltage options: 100 or 200 V
  • Wattage options: 45 to 1600 W
  • Power Density: 16 to 69 W/cm²
  • Resistance Value: 25 to 400 Ω
  • Optional Type K thermocouple and PTFE insulated leads

Fields of Application
The AIN heater is applicable in semiconductor manufacturing, automotive, medical, packaging machines, and railway industries.

Precautions
  • Ensure proper adhesion of the heater to the object being heated.
  • Avoid warping or deformation under rapid temperature changes.
  • Operate within specified temperature and voltage ranges.
  • Do not damage the heater surface or lead wires.
  • Do not use damaged heaters or excessively tighten them during installation.
  • Terminate operation immediately if the heater is damaged.
  • Avoid placing low thermal durability components near the heater during long operations.
